Rules for thee but not for me 

Usually a phrase said when cops abuse their power doing things as if they're above the law, it's a saying when someone believes they have authority over the law to do whatever they want.
Person 1: "holy shit... did you see that cop just blow through that red light?"
Person 2: "rules for thee but not for me"

Purple Patch 

To describe coming into something good, coming into good luck and or good times.

Like walking over small green hills in the countryside then coming across a purple patch of flowers, thus it being unique and out of the ordinary.
I hit a real purple patch.

The other day this good thing happened unexpectedly then I was lucky with this, it was unique, I hit a real purple patch.
